Suboxone combines buprenorphine and naloxone in one medication for opioid addiction. It relieves withdrawal and cravings, and because buprenorphine's opioid effect levels off at higher doses, the overdose risk is far lower than with full opioids.

In Glendale, Suboxone is prescribed in office based and outpatient settings, so treatment can fit around work and family life. Of Glendale's 9 rehab centers, 7 report buprenorphine with naloxone (Suboxone).

Suboxone rehab: common questions

How do I start Suboxone?

You start after early withdrawal has begun so the medication does not trigger sudden, severe symptoms. A prescriber will time the first dose with you.

How long do people take Suboxone?

Months to years. Evidence favors staying on it while it is helping, and stopping should be a planned, gradual taper with your prescriber.

Do I need counseling along with Suboxone?

Medication works best paired with counseling, and most programs include it. The combination addresses both the physical and behavioral sides of addiction.
